ReportConfigDataset interface
De definitie van gegevens die aanwezig zijn in het rapport.
Eigenschappen
| aggregation | Woordenlijst van aggregatie-expressie die in het rapport moet worden gebruikt. De sleutel van elk item in de woordenlijst is de alias voor de samengevoegde kolom. Rapport kan maximaal 2 aggregatiecomponenten bevatten. |
| configuration | Bevat configuratie-informatie voor de gegevens in het rapport. De configuratie wordt genegeerd als aggregatie en groepering worden opgegeven. |
| filter | Heeft filterexpressie die moet worden gebruikt in het rapport. |
| granularity | De granulariteit van rijen in het rapport. |
| grouping | Matrix van groeperen op expressie die in het rapport moet worden gebruikt. Rapport kan maximaal 2 group by-componenten bevatten. |
| sorting | Rangschikking per expressie voor gebruik in het rapport. |
Eigenschapdetails
aggregation
Woordenlijst van aggregatie-expressie die in het rapport moet worden gebruikt. De sleutel van elk item in de woordenlijst is de alias voor de samengevoegde kolom. Rapport kan maximaal 2 aggregatiecomponenten bevatten.
aggregation?: {[propertyName: string]: ReportConfigAggregation}
Waarde van eigenschap
{[propertyName: string]: ReportConfigAggregation}
configuration
Bevat configuratie-informatie voor de gegevens in het rapport. De configuratie wordt genegeerd als aggregatie en groepering worden opgegeven.
configuration?: ReportConfigDatasetConfiguration
Waarde van eigenschap
filter
Heeft filterexpressie die moet worden gebruikt in het rapport.
filter?: ReportConfigFilter
Waarde van eigenschap
granularity
De granulariteit van rijen in het rapport.
granularity?: string
Waarde van eigenschap
string
grouping
Matrix van groeperen op expressie die in het rapport moet worden gebruikt. Rapport kan maximaal 2 group by-componenten bevatten.
grouping?: ReportConfigGrouping[]
Waarde van eigenschap
sorting
Rangschikking per expressie voor gebruik in het rapport.
sorting?: ReportConfigSorting[]